Output 76c18f8dd8140fabd779cdbaf88b7d7d50c1c9ec446e60ef0d1f7b7309072133:0

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d108a741909f043979af1a3cfb724947006fa35 OP_EQUAL
address
37FtxXGddDuocwhvSCa3bMmaajYRpTe8Eq
transaction
76c18f8dd8140fabd779cdbaf88b7d7d50c1c9ec446e60ef0d1f7b7309072133